The housing market in Denton, KS is booming. The median value of homes here is $155,800, which is much lower than the US House Median Value of $338,100. In the last year, the appreciation of home values in Denton has been 11.73%, higher than the national average of 8.27%. This indicates a strong and healthy housing market in Denton with positive growth potential for investors and residents alike.

The median home cost in Denton is $155,800.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 83.3%. Home Appreciation in Denton is up 13.7%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Denton real estate is 78 years old
The Rental Market in Denton
- Renters make up 7.1% of the Denton population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Denton, are available to rent
